linux
1. 刪除
rm -rf 加資料夾名
rm -rf core-ub..3* //以這個開頭的所有檔案
2. ll -lrt 按時間順序列表展示檔案
ll列表, ls
3. top linux下的常用效能分析工具,能夠實時顯示出系統中各個程序資源占用情況
4. uptime 當前時間 系統命令
檢視時間 date
修改時間
date -s 21:30:30
設定日期
date -s 2006/04/17
5. df 檢查檔案系統磁碟空間占用情況
6. ps -ef 檢視所有程序
ps -ef|grep mysql 檢視程序名為mysql的程序
7. kill -9 + pid kill掉程序號為pid的程序,有時候需要使用su root,然後使用exit或者ctrl+d退出root許可權
8. tcpdump tcp -i eth0 -s 0 port 3869 -w.pcap抓取網絡卡0 埠為3869的包
tcpdump -i eth0 -s 2000 -w temp.pcap
9. 目錄
pwd顯示當前目錄
cd ../..向上移動兩級目錄
cd cd~帶到登陸目錄 cd/到當前使用者根目錄
cd ~ywx...帶到home下的名為ywx...
10.解壓
11.v
按esc鍵 跳到命令模式,然後:
:w 儲存檔案但不退出vi
:w file 將修改另外儲存到file中,不退出vi
:w! 強制儲存,不推出vi
:wq 儲存檔案並退出vi
:wq! 強制儲存檔案,並退出vi
q: 不儲存檔案,退出vi
:q! 不儲存檔案,強制退出vi
:e! 放棄所有修改,從上次儲存檔案開始再編輯
mysql
1. 啟動:net start mysql
2.進入:mysql -u odb_user -p123456 ubpdb
mysql -u root -p -u root -p databasename;
mysql -u root mysql -h localhost -p databasename;
資料庫備份
mysqldump -u odb_user -p123456 --opt ubpdb > /home/ubpdb.sql //使用者名稱odb_user 密碼123456, 資料庫名字ubpdb
資料庫恢復
mysqldump -u odb_user -p123456 --opt ubpdb > /home/ubpdb.sql
3. svn
svn up更新
svn cleanup清除
1、svn info顯示原svn url:
> svn info
path: url:svn: 當前目錄
repository root: svn:
2、執行svn relocate,命令格式為:svn switch --relocate 原svn_url 新svn_url
> svn switch --relocate svn: 切換到新目錄
工作中用到的命令
svn checkout username password 點評 1 將檔案checkout到本地目錄 svn checkout path path是伺服器上的目錄 例如 svn checkout svn 簡寫 svn co 2 往版本庫中新增新的檔案 svn add file 例如 svn ad...
工作中用到的linux 命令
tar zxvf tar.gz 解壓 增加使用者組 groupadd mysql 增加使用者 useradd r g mysql mysql 鏈結 名 ln s usr local mysql 5.7.23 linux glibc2.12 x86 64 mysql 類似快捷方式 建立mysql資料夾...
工作中用到的linux命令
1.linux檢視並殺死被占用的埠 sudo apt get install lsof 安裝lsof ps ef grep 應用名稱 查詢對應的程序id netstat lnp grep 程序id或者埠號 查詢所佔的埠號或者對應的程序id sudo lsof i 埠號 查詢對應的程序號 sudo k...